At a basic level, a federal indictment means a grand jury has formally accused one or more individuals of specific crimes, and the case will move into the courtroom phase. In Oklahoma, these matters are handled in federal district courts, where procedures follow national rules while also respecting local practices. Where Can I Find Official Information on Federal Cases in Oklahoma?

The primary source is the public PACER system, which provides electronic access to federal court documents for a fee. Many courts also offer free access through their own portals or by visiting the clerk's office in person. What Do Indictment Documents Actually Tell Me?

An indictment outlines the charges, cites relevant laws, and lists the alleged acts in plain language, though it can still be dense for newcomers. By reading these documents and comparing them with later filings, such as motions or plea agreements, you can track how the case evolves. Things People Often Misunderstand

One common myth is that an indictment automatically means someone is guilty, when in reality it is only the formal charging stage before any evidence has been tested in court. Another misunderstanding is that all federal cases in Oklahoma are handled the same way, when in fact they can differ based on jurisdiction, the specific statutes involved, and the procedural choices of prosecutors and defenders.
